About The Position

North American Slate is seeking an experienced Territory Sales Representative for the Mid-Western region to drive sales of our premium quality slate products to architects, contractors, and suppliers. The ideal candidate will have strong knowledge of slate and/or roofing, strong selling and closing skills, and project management skills to help drive our business. The Midwestern Region territory comprises Illinois (IL), Indiana (IN), Michigan (MI), and Wisconsin (WI). This role requires a 'road warrior' who loves the thrill of the 'hunt' and knows how to close the 'deal'. Join our company to help grow our diverse client portfolio within a growing industry steeped in history and beauty.

Responsibilities

  • Identify and prospect new customers while building long-lasting partnerships.
  • Engage with contractors, suppliers, and architects to secure slate product specifications and include natural slate into project designs.
  • Deliver expert product consultation on slate types and colors, and suitability for potential applications.
  • Present timely and accurate information related to pricing, contract terms and potential concessions for prospective clients.
  • Achieve sales objectives through slate product/industry knowledge, client development and competitive analysis.
  • Manage entire sales life cycle from prospecting to closing the deal.
  • Provide consistent reporting to leadership for current and future sales and project oversight.
  • Generate sales forecasting and monitor pipeline projects to reach sales targets.
  • Manage leads within assigned territory, sending information and samples to prospective clients, while coordinating logistics.
  • Estimate, quote and analyze costs to strategically sell offered slate products in a competitive market.
  • Coordinate account management including lead generation, qualification, product presentation, negotiation, closing the sale and post-sale account management.
